What controls elevation of scapula?
Trapezius (Accessory nerve), levator scapulae (dorsal scapular)
What controls depression of the scapula?
Pectoralis minor (medial pectoral), trapezius (accessory nerve)
What controls protraction of scapula?
Pectoralis minor (medial pectoral), serratus anterior (long thoracic nerve)
What controls retraction of the scapula?
Trapezius (accessory), Rhomboid major and minor (dorsal scapular)
What controls lateral rotation of the scapula?
Serratus anterior(long thoracic nerve), trapezius (accessory nerve)
What controls medial rotation of the scapula?
Levator scapulae (dorsal scapular), rhomboids (dorsal scapular)

Describe the scapular arterial anastomosis - what vessels contribute and how do they communicate with one another?
extensive arterial anastomosis around the scapula and on its costal and dorsal surfaces. it provides a connection between the third part of the subclavian and the axillary artery
What aspect of the shoulder joint is not reinforced by the rotator cuff and what is the clinical significance of this?
The anteroinferior aspect of the joint is not reinforced by the rotator cuff, which makes this region of the shoulder somewhat loose, unstable and easily dislocated or strained. the muscles supporting this are constantly contracted and can sometimes lead to tendonitis
What are the boundaries of the quadrangular space?
Teres minor (superior), Long head of triceps brachii (medial), surgical neck of humerus (lateral), teres major (inferior)
What structures pass through the quadrangular space?
Axillary nerve that innervates the deltoid muscle and the teres minor, and the posterior humeral circumflex artery that supplies the deltoid muscle
Describe the anatomical basis of “winged scapula”
damage to the long thoracic nerve prevents protraction by the serrates anterior
Describe the relationship of the axilla nerve to the surgical neck of the humerus. What symptoms would result from a fracture of the surgical neck of the humerus?
Damage to the axillary nerve affects function of the teres minor and deltoid muscles, resulting in loss of abduction of arm (from 15-90 degrees), weak flexion, extension, and rotation of shoulder as well as loss of sensation of the skin over a small part of the lateral shoulder
